Dear Mr Schmalenberger,
Thank you for your request for access to the
"written comments of 8 November 2022" referred to in
document 14954/22 ADD 1.1
In fact, the comments of the German delegation were made
orally during a meeting of the Working
Party on Telecommunications and Information Society on 8 November 2022. The word
‘written’
was used inadvertently in the statement.
Nevertheless, you will find attached documents
WK 13231/2022 and
WK 13423/2022 which
contain the German comments on the third compromise text on the
proposal for a Regulation of
the European Parliament and of the Council laying down harmonised rules on artificial intelligence
(Artificial Intelligence Act) and amending certain Union legislative acts and which might be of
interest to you.
